    Webb Middle School School

    I attended a community fair at WebB Middle school which brought in different resources to help the community such as free flu shots, college info, healthcare information, resources for minorities and support post election. I gave a presentation on how undocumented students can still go to college regardless of immigration status. I met with parents and their children and guided them through college application process.

    DEEP Forum at Round Rock

    This forum was intended to help undocumented students lear about the financial process and the extra steps they would need to take in order to qualify for state aid. This wasn't the only forum Ive been to in regards to presenting this information and even though at this one no student showed it reminded me of how students believe that they are not able to make it, and how so many volunteers are willing to give their time no matter how many students may or may not show up.

    DACA Clinic May 2, 2015

    This last DACA clinic of the summer, I was able to train another person to collect the stories of the individuals who attended our clinic. I was able to show them how instead of asking straight up questions to speak as if you were having a conversation. I enjoyed teaching others how to talk to individuals and make them comfortable with speaking about personal issues.

    DACA Clinic December 6, 2014

    A DACA clinic is more than just a clinic in which we fill out DACA applications for low income families. We provide assurance that they do not have to spend hundreds of dollars to get a so-called high class lawyer you do their application. As we have these clinics we try to bring the community together in helping each other with such tasks; and as one we grow into a much brighter future.
